Per the last update on this (.168):

"Insane mode is now more insane! Your car accelerates even faster when in insane mode, improving 0-to-60-mph performance in this mode from 3.2 seconds to 3.1 seconds. The accelerator pedal is also now more responsive in insane mode."

Insane and Sport are still there on P85D.
However, I don't think that they are interchangeable.
I've played around to see if both are similarly efficient during my hilly commute and I feel that Sport is more efficient than Insane.
I can get to the low 300s Wh/mi in Sport, while I am stuck in the mid to high 300s in Insane, even when mostly using TACC and Range Mode on the highway.
This difference may be due to the more powerful rear motor in the P85D, compared with the 85D.
Maybe that's why both driving modes are still available on the P85D.
